In Commiskey, homeowners frequently deal with seasonal invaders like ants, spiders, and mice, as well as occasional issues with termites and wasps. Due to our humid summers and cold winters, pests often seek shelter indoors in the fall and become active again in spring. Being most vigilant during these seasonal transitions and after heavy rains (which can drive ants inside) is key to early prevention.
Costs vary based on the pest, property size, and service type. For example, a one-time treatment for ants or spiders might range from $100-$300, while ongoing quarterly plans typically cost $40-$70 per visit. Termite treatments are more significant, often $800-$2,500+, due to the extensive methods required. Always get itemized quotes from local providers, as pricing in our rural region can differ from larger Indiana cities.
Yes. In Indiana, any company applying pesticides must have a licensed Commercial Applicator registered with the Office of the Indiana State Chemist (OISC). Always verify this license before hiring. Additionally, for termite treatments, companies are required to provide you with a detailed contract and, in most cases, a warranty, which is governed by Indiana state law to protect homeowners.

Given our climate and rural setting, preventative plans are highly recommended. Reactive treatments often cost more over time and may not prevent structural damage from pests like termites or carpenter ants, which are present in Southern Indiana. A scheduled preventative service creates a consistent barrier, stopping infestations before they start and providing greater peace of mind throughout the year.
